I think that your RUT241 /etc/board.json file got corrupted during installation. Probably best just try to install it again with keep settings off. Or if you want to recover without flashing new fw you can try executing few commands via cli:
rm /etc/board.json
config_generate
If neither of these help then there might be bigger problems
